Abstract

A natural language test case for an application is automatically converted into a test script by a test script generator. During the generation of the test script, the test script generator may access a blueprint of the application. The blueprint may include a time-evolving model of the application, which may include a set of translations and a state machine model of the application. The state machine model may include a state space and a set of state transitions. During the test script generation process, the blueprint may be continually updated to include new knowledge of the application. The test script generator may communicate with an artificial intelligence (AI) engine in order to determine the semantic similarity between two phrases, convert images into textual description, and perform tasks requiring the use of a large language model (LLM).
